Abstract:
This chapter reviews the EU's and euro area's financial history over the last 15 years, thus spanning three main crises: the Financial Turmoil (FT) in 2007 and subsequent Global Financial Crisis (GFC) in 2008-9, the euro area sovereign debt crisis (SDC) in 2010-12 and the ongoing Coronavirus (Covid-19) crisis that started in early in 2020. Each crisis had distinct origins as well as economic, financial and social impacts. All three crises have been accompanied by important reforms of the EU's governance and financial architecture.
